Job description

Power Solutions is seeking an entry level Development Engineer. This is an entry level position designed to train a recent graduate/or early career engineer in new product development for power electrical interconnects used in Datacom Applications. Examples of our product applications in Datacom are power from facility to data center rack, data center rack architecture, server & storage, and networking.

Upon placement, candidates will receive one-on-one career development from experienced technical staff in areas of product development, testing, and qualification of new products.

Training program will consist of the following areas:

  • Electrical Connector Basics
  • Electrical Power Connectors
  • Simulation (mechanical, electrical, thermal)
  • Manufacturing Methods and Disciplines (e.g., electroplating, metal stamping, plastic molding, product assembly)
  • Product Testing (internal product qualification, external certification testing)
Responsibilities (after initial training program)
  • Conceptualize, design, and develop power connector solutions as required by the BU strategic roadmap.
  • Complete engineering deliverables to ensure design verification.
    • Design for Manufacturing
    • Tolerance Analysis
    • Product Simulations
    • Design Failure Mode and Effects Analysis
    • Create 3D models and 2D drawings
  • Define Product, Application, and Packaging specifications
  • Define verification and product qualification test plans
  • Work closely with NPI and manufacturing engineering to support product transfer to manufacturing

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ering or related degree
  • 0-3 years of experience in connector design
  • General knowledge of 3D modeling using PTC Creo (formerly Pro/ENGINEER) and/or SolidWorks
  • Ability to communicate well with Global Customers and all levels of the organization including Management, Marketing, Sales, Process Engineering, Test Lab personnel, other Engineers (local and global).

Ability to prioritize, work to meet objectives and to manage multiple activities/projects simultaneously.
